The sky is setting the stage for a true pivot year, and we’re stepping into it with clear eyes and steady feet. Saturn and Neptune move into Aries and lock into a rare conjunction that tests what we’ve built, reveals what was propped up by wishful thinking, and challenges us to craft stronger foundations for our dreams. It’s heat meeting haze: courage surges while clarity wavers. We walk through what that actually means for your choices, your timing, and the parts of life that need to be redesigned rather than defended.

I break down Neptune’s long stay in Aries and how it supercharges imagination, activism, and spiritual conviction, while blurring the fine print. Then we get into Saturn in Aries—why this placement pushes us to slow down inside fast-moving circumstances, and how to use guardrails that protect momentum instead of killing it. Together, these two outer planets act like an audit of your reality: flimsy castles erode, honest plans survive, and better blueprints emerge. We talk dates to watch, the February 20 exact conjunction, and the preview period that hinted at these themes earlier in 2025.

If you have major Aries, Cancer, Libra, or Capricorn placements, you’ll likely feel the pressure points most, with Aquarius not far behind under Saturn’s gaze. I also mention Saturn returns, squares, and oppositions so you can map your personal cycle and stop fearing the lesson. Expect practical framing on staying grounded: rituals that keep you clear, decision checks that cut through fog, and ways to let an old dream go without losing your fire. So anyway, let's get into the specifics of this. On January 26th, Neptune is going to enter Aries. He initially was there from March 30th to October 22nd, and then he went back into Pisces, and now January 26th, he comes into Aries again. He does not leave until March 23rd, 2039. And as you all know, I do not like Neptune. In this position, you know, I have very conflicted feelings about it. Neptune is the planet of dreams and compassion and spirituality to some extent. And that's why everybody's always like, Kate, why don't you like Neptune? Because he's also illusion, delusion, lies, um, cloudy thinking, cloudy vision. It's just really hard to be clear about anything when Neptune is involved. In Pisces, it wasn't so bad. He's the modern ruler. Please everybody remember that Jupiter is the real ruler, but he's the modern ruler of Pisces. He's the god of the sea, right? And Pisces is the ocean. So we've had a sort of better run with Neptune for a while, but Aries is fire. And that's a whole different thing. So let me give you the good side. And again, this is just the Neptune piece. The good side is we might have great ambition and great fiery energy behind our dreams, you know, the those things that we want for ourselves, for the world, for the for our lives, our imagination, all of that. We're going to act boldly and courageously. You know, that's Aries. And we're going to fight for our dreams. Aries is ruled by Mars, the warrior god. So this willingness and this ability to fight for our dreams, fight for our beliefs, fight for our spirituality, all of those kinds of things are going to be up. And that is the really good bit that we're going to have when Neptune is in Aries. And remember, this is a very long transit all the way to 2039. This is a big, giant deal. And it's once in a lifetime that we're going to have the exact configurations that we're getting the beginning of 2026. But Neptune doesn't allow us to see things clearly. It's like we're underwater, right? So it's like, yes, I'll fight for my dreams, but I may not even see my own dreams very clearly. Does that make sense? I know that sounds sort of contradictory, but it's like I may be fighting for things that I'm a little foggy on, you know, that I need to fight for this belief, you know, but I'm I'm not even seeing the situation as clearly as I wish I were, given that I'm going in guns ablazing. So it's an interesting time. There's great potential, but there's also the chance that things are gonna get really murky in really hot ways, Aries, right? So how do we deal with this? It is gonna be really important to stay grounded and try to be sure that we're seeing things clearly before we start the full-on battle. Now that's one of the ways that Saturn coming into the picture actually could be helpful. So Saturn is going to come into Aries and immediately go into a conjunction with Neptune. That happens on February 13th. So isn't Valentine's Day gonna be something? Now he's been in Aries before already this year. He went in on May 24th and was there through September 1st. So you might think back to that period of time. What were the themes coming up for you? Because that was like preview of coming attractions. Neptune and Saturn were very close to each other. I think within one degree, they weren't quite in an exact conjunction, but darn it, that is close enough for me. So whatever was going on through the middle of 2025, kind of look at those themes. They're back up. Saturn will stay until April 12th, 2028. Okay, so he's got about a two and a half year transit. Also, oh my gosh, you guys, everybody wants to know about their Saturn returns. Saturn return is when transiting Saturn comes back around to the exact position of your birth Saturn, right? It happens about every 29-ish years and it marks major life changes. But people forget that there's not just a Saturn return, there's a Saturn square and a Saturn opposition, and then the final Saturn square before the next Saturn return. This is a really big deal Saturn going on in Aries. So look to see where Saturn is in your natal chart and see what angle it's making. Oh my gosh. Can I just skip 2026 for real? Saturn is weak in Aries. Saturn is Earth, he's all about being grounded and building, taking things slow. And Aries is impulsive, he's direct action, he wants to go now. You know, it's just a whole different vibe, a whole different energy. So Saturn's in his fall, and yeah, he's just not that happy. So slow Saturn going into fast Aries is really going to try to almost force us to develop a kind of wisdom. We're gonna have circumstances going on saying, go, go, go, do it, do it, do it. You gotta do this thing, make it happen, you know, whatever. And Saturn is having none of that. And it can be a really uncomfortable kind of period. And remember, this is two years, you know, we're we're not even close to being done with this energy yet. So if we fight it, I tell everyone when they come to me for their Saturn returns, everyone's terrified of them, right? And I tell everyone, it they're only awful if Saturn has to kick your butt. If you lean into the lessons, Saturn is wise. You know, he's the wisdom of age and experience. So this transit, I really think is going to be sort of forcing us, or yeah, I would like to put it more gently, but I think kind of forcing us to develop a kind of wisdom and um that sort of discipline to be able to slow down even when circumstances are pushing us to sort of barrel ahead. Does that make sense? Now let's get to what I'm actually talking about, which is the Saturn conjunction with Neptune, which is going exact on February 20th. Oh my goodness, this is once in a lifetime. It's a kind of reset that is coming. Um, these are outer planets, which means they're slow to act on us. They stay in signs for a long time because they need time to really accomplish their jobs there. So this conjunction really has to do with dissolving structures that were built on illusion. Does that make sense? So Neptune dissolves. Neptune's all about illusion, delusion, all of that kind of stuff. Saturn is about structures. So we put those together, and it is going to be time when we may get very dramatic messages about what parts of our lives were just built on something that's not real, that's flimsy, that was some kind of dream or fantasy that just didn't have the substance under it to hold it up.
